Nat West bank

Just a quick warning;

I tried to get on line with the Nat West bank yesterday afternoon at 1500Z from my favourites list and was unable to do so (1mg broadband). I edited the address line on IE to www.nwolb and without noticing it IE changed it to nwilb and took me to an identical site. where the usual questions were asked.

One difference was that the pin number request didn't move to the next box when it asked for 3 numbers and instead of asking for random letters in the password it asked for the password in full.

At this point my suspicions were confirmed and I left the site.

I have informed Nat West of the site.
